Ads keep us online. Without them, we wouldn't exist. We don't have paywalls or sell mods - we never will. But every month we have large bills and running ads is our only way to cover them. Please consider unblocking us. Thank you from GameBanana <3

SuperHot

A Config Script for Team Fortress 2

No ads for members. Membership is 100% free. Sign up!
70 2 kb Raw Code
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
// superhot.cfg
// Play SuperHot, but without playing SuperHot! (?)
// Works with any Source game on single player or private servers

// Usage:
//  alias sh_speed "host_timescale <NUMBER 0 -> 1"
//   - Sets the default speed while no keys are pressed
//  
//  sh_off
//   - Resets your keybinds for you. How sweet.
//  sh_on
//   - Reresets your keybinds after you used sh_on

// Issues:
//  Once movement keys are released, you will still move a little bit in slow motion
//  This script only detects if the dedicated movement keys are pressed
//   - If you bind a weird key like H to +forward, +attack, etc. then you will not slow down

sv_cheats 1

alias sh_speed "host_timescale 0.2"

sh_speed

alias prep "alias timescale sh_speed"
alias x "alias timescale host_timescale 1"
alias check_keys "prep;w;a;s;d;m1;timescale"

alias +w "+forward;host_timescale 1;alias w x"
alias -w "-forward;alias w;check_keys"

alias +a "+moveleft;host_timescale 1;alias a x"
alias -a "-moveleft;alias a;check_keys"

alias +s "+back;host_timescale 1;alias s x"
alias -s "-back;alias s;check_keys"

alias +d "+moveright;host_timescale 1;alias d x"
alias -d "-moveright;alias d;check_keys"

alias +m1 "+attack;host_timescale 1;alias m1 x"
alias -m1 "-attack;alias m1;check_keys"

alias +m2 "+attack2;host_timescale 1;alias m2 x"
alias -m2 "-attack2;alias m2;check_keys"

alias w ""
alias a ""
alias s ""
alias d ""
alias m1 ""
alias m2 ""

bind w +w
bind a +a
bind s +s
bind d +d
bind mouse1 +m1
bind mouse2 +m2

alias sh_off "rebindw;rebinda;rebinds;rebindd;rebindm1;rebindm2"

alias rebindw "bind w +forward"
alias rebinda "bind a +moveleft"
alias rebinds "bind s +back"
alias rebindd "bind d +moveright"
alias rebindm1 "bind MOUSE1 +attack"
alias rebindm2 "bind MOUSE2 +attack2"

alias sh_on "exec superhot"

Play Superhot... kinda!

Some time ago I witnessed a Superhot-style script for TF2 on here.
Today I decided I wanted to actually try it out for myself, and... it sucks.

So, I made my own!
Now it actually works: as long as some movement or action key is pressed, you will stay in real-time.
No more issues with pressing one key, then another, then releasing the first key and a bunch of other nonsense.

Anyways, how to use:
  sh_off - Rebinds movement and action keys to default.
  sh_on - Re-rebinds your keys and you can play Superhot again

It's that simple! Go have fun for a few minutes before you get bored and play the regular game.

(Protip

 mp_autoteambalance 0

 mp_teams_unbalance_limit 0

 mp_restartgame 1

 tf_bot_add 6

End Protip)
Sign up to access this!

Embed

Share banner
Image URL
HTML embed code
BB embed code
Markdown embed code

Credits

Me.
JTurtle
made this.

Submitter

JTurtle avatar
JTurtle Joined 5mo ago
Offline
JTurtle
Creator
Sign up to access this!
Sign up to access this!
Sign up to access this!

Game

Sign up to access this!

Category

License

The JT License:

I don't fuckin care what you do with this, go wild, edit it, sell it, not my problem.

Share

  • Share on Reddit
  • Share on Twitter
  • Share on Facebook
  • 2
  • 213
  • 1
  • 3d

More Other/Misc Scripts